時間:2020-02-11 17:48:38 來源:IT貓撲網(wǎng) 作者:網(wǎng)管聯(lián)盟 我要評論(0)
出于各種原因,我們經常需要用到PHP腳本運行環(huán)境。雖然說目前已經有N多集成類的PHP架設軟件,也的確能運行起PHP程序,不過效果或許都不太盡人意。這篇文章主要講述如何搭建一個相對穩(wěn)定和安全的PHP運行環(huán)境。
首先,提一下要準備的軟件:
1、Windows 2003 企業(yè)版 SP2+IIS6.0(自備);
3、php-5.2.6(點此到官方下載);
4、Zend 3.3.3(點此到官方下載);
5、phpMyAdmin-2.11.8.1(點此到官方下載)
以上所有程序均為官方最新版,下載鏈接均為官方提供的可靠鏈接,請放心下載使用。
下面開始介紹安裝過程:
一、安裝IIS6.0
安裝好Windows 2003操作系統(tǒng),更新完所有系統(tǒng)補丁,然后在"控制面板"->"添加或刪除程序"->"添加/刪除Windows組件"->雙擊"應用程序服務器"->然后選中"Internet信息服務(IIS)"->點擊"確定"->等待安裝完畢即可。
二、安裝MySQL
解壓縮mysql-5.0.67-win32.zip,然后雙擊運行Setup.exe。
直接一路Next,直到這里
再點擊"Finish",然后到這里
再"Next",選擇第一項"Detailed Configuration"
繼續(xù)"Next",到這里選擇第二項"Server Machine"
再"Next",到這里選擇第三項"Non-Transactional Database Only"
"Next",然后選擇第三項"Maual Setting"設置MySQL的最大連接數(shù)(一般不超過512,可視服務器性能和需求自定)
繼續(xù)"Next",這里需要注意,要去掉"Enable Strict Mode"前面的勾,端口默認為3306。
"Next",這里選擇第三項"Manual Selected Default Character Set / Collation",設置默認編碼字符集,一般設為gbk
"Next",把"Include Bin Directory in Windows PATH"前面的勾打上,添加進系統(tǒng)環(huán)境變量里
"Next",輸入root用戶密碼兩次,出于安全考慮,一般不要選"Enable root access from remote machines",允許數(shù)據(jù)庫外連是很危險的
"Next",然后點擊"Execute"
稍等一會,再點擊"Finish"。
到這里MySQL就安裝完畢了,我們來測試一下是否正常工作了。開始->程序->MySQL->MySQL Server 5.0->MySQL Command Line Client,在彈出的窗口輸入剛才安裝MySQL時設置的root用戶的密碼,看到類似這樣的信息就說明MySQL正常工作了。
至此,MySQL的安裝、配置、檢測都全部做完了。
三、配置PHP
1、設置PHP目錄
解壓縮下載回來的php-5.2.6-Win32.zip到一個文件夾,我這里是c:\php。進入c:\php,把php.ini-dist文件重命名為php.ini,雙擊打開,搜索"extension_dir",一般直接跳到extension_dir = "./"這里,然后把"./"改成"ext"(也就是把extension_dir = "./"改成extension_dir = "ext"。),這里是設置dll擴展文件夾目錄的。然后再搜索"Windows Extensions",在跳到的位置再稍微下拉一點點,把下面幾個擴展前面注釋用的分號去掉:
extension=php_gd2.dll
extension=php_mbstring.dll
extension=php_mysql.dll
改完之后保存退出。如果需要添加別的一些模塊支持,把相應擴展前面的分號去掉即可。
2、添加PHP環(huán)境變量
右鍵單擊"我的電腦"->"屬性"->"高級"->"環(huán)境變量"->"系統(tǒng)變量"->"Path"->"編輯(I)"->"變量值(V)"最后面加上";c:\php"(注意最前面有個分號,起間隔作用,千萬不能少?。?/p>
然后"確定"。再點擊"系統(tǒng)變量"下面的"新建(W)","變量名"處填入"PHPRC","變量值"處填入"c:\php",然后"確定"即可。
配置完畢了,如何檢查是否配置正常了呢?方法很簡單,開始->運行,輸入"ext",這時候如果彈出一個放著清一色dll文件的文件夾(其實就是c:\php\ext)就說明已經配置成功了。
3、測試PHP是否正常工作
開始->程序->管理工具->Internet 信息服務(IIS)管理器,打開IIS管理器。右鍵單擊"網(wǎng)站"->"新建"->"網(wǎng)站"->"下一步"->"描述"(填入"PHP")->"下一步"("網(wǎng)站IP地址"不用改,"網(wǎng)站TCP端口"保留默認的80即可,"此網(wǎng)站的主機頭"
關鍵詞標簽:phpMyAdmin,mysql
相關閱讀 網(wǎng)頁視頻如何下載?適合所有網(wǎng)站的視頻下載方法圖文教程 phpMyAdmin2.6以上版本數(shù)據(jù)亂碼問題 MySQL中文亂碼,phpmyadmin亂碼,php亂碼 產生原因及其解決方法 insert、delete等命令的語法及在phpmyadmin中的操作 ACCESS復合承載 性能超越MYSQL Apache+PHP+MySQL配置攻略
熱門文章 ISAPI Rewrite實現(xiàn)IIS圖片防盜鏈 IIS6.0下配置MySQL+PHP5+Zend+phpMyAdmin 在Windows服務器上快速架設視頻編解碼器全攻略 win2000server IIS和tomcat5多站點配置
時間:2022-01-25 19:53:19
時間:2022-01-25 19:43:51
時間:2022-01-25 16:19:16
時間:2022-01-25 11:34:12
時間:2021-12-14 12:08:00
時間:2020-01-11 11:30:54
人氣排行 XAMPP配置出現(xiàn)403錯誤“Access forbidden!”的解決辦法 WIN2003 IIS6.0+PHP+ASP+MYSQL優(yōu)化配置 訪問網(wǎng)站403錯誤 Forbidden解決方法 如何從最大用戶并發(fā)數(shù)推算出系統(tǒng)最大用戶數(shù) Server Application Unavailable的解決辦法 報錯“HTTP/1.1 400 Bad Request”的處理方法 Windows Server 2003的Web接口 http 500內部服務器錯誤的解決辦法(windows xp + IIS5.0)